Samsung Galaxy S23: The Features We Need to See
Commentary: Samsung must improve some of the basics on its flagship phone.
The Samsung Galaxy S22 has an upgraded camera that’s better at seeing in the dark, and it has an upgraded aesthetic. But we need so much more for Samsung to blow us away with their Galaxy S23, which is expected to debut on Wednesday at Samsung Unpacked.
In particular, I’d like to see longer-lasting batteries, more photographic features and faster charging that doesn’t require an expensive adapter and more photographic features.
Read more: How to Watch Samsung Unpacked
Samsung leads the smartphone industry, with 21% of the worldwide market in the third quarter of 2022, according to Counterpoint Research. Upgrading core features like the camera and battery could help it maintain that top spot, especially as it faces increased competition from Apple and Google.
Longer battery life for the regular Galaxy S23
Battery life can never be long enough, but the standard-issue Galaxy S device is in particular need of a boost. The 6.1-inch Galaxy S22 generally lived up to Samsung’s claims of all-day battery life, but sometimes just barely. After using it for a month straight, I noticed the battery level dipped roughly to 30% or 40% by 9 p.m., even with the always-on display turned off and the screen’s refresh rate set to standard. That’s enough to get through a work day, but you’ll likely want to pack a charger if you have after-work plans or a long commute home.
The Galaxy S22 has the smallest battery (3,700-mAh capacity) of the three phones in the Galaxy S22 lineup, and it shows. For example, I was pleasantly surprised when the 6.6-inch Galaxy S22 Plus, which has a larger 4,500-mAh capacity, lasted for about a day and a half when I reviewed it in February. I also had the refresh rate set to high, which typically drains battery more quickly. The Galaxy S22 Ultra, which has a 6.8-inch screen and a 5,000-mAh battery, had similar battery life.
It makes sense that the Galaxy S22 line’s smallest phone would also have the smallest battery. But I hope Samsung finds a way to improve battery life on next year’s 6.1-inch Galaxy phone, whether it’s through better power efficiency or a larger physical battery. After all, Apple made upgrades to the iPhone 13 Mini that gave it an extra two to three hours of battery life compared to the iPhone 12 Mini. Battery life is the main complaint I had about the Galaxy S22, and addressing that would make the Galaxy S23 an even more compelling choice for Android fans who prefer smaller phones.
Korean news outlet The Elec indicates that could indeed be the case, as it reports that Samsung aims to increase the Galaxy S23’s battery capacity by about 5%.
More clever camera features
The Galaxy S22’s 50-megapixel camera and the Galaxy S22 Ultra’s 108-megapixel camera capture impressively colorful and detailed photos. I only wish there was more you could do with those cameras when it comes to editing and software features.
The Galaxy S22 lineup has shooting options like panorama, night mode, portrait mode, slow motion, super slow motion and Director’s View, which lets you record video using two different lenses simultaneously. Then there’s Single Take, which creates multiple stylized shots with a single press of the shutter button. You can also download the Expert Raw app to get more granular control over photo settings.
But not much has changed between the Galaxy S21 and Galaxy S22 when it comes to camera features and shooting modes. I’d love to see Samsung take a page from Google, which regularly adds nifty camera tricks that feel practical rather than gimmicky. For example, Google introduced a new feature on the Pixel 7 and 7 Pro called Photo Unblur, which sharpens low-quality photos, even ones taken with an older camera. Photo Unblur builds on Face Unblur, a previous Pixel 6 and 6 Pro camera feature I also appreciate. As the name implies, Face Unblur freezes moving subjects that may otherwise look blurry.
Features like these show that Google is not just thinking about camera quality, but also ways to eliminate everyday annoyances with mobile photography. Many of Samsung’s updates, on the other hand, feel aimed at giving content creators more tools for capturing different types of shots and video clips.
While the Galaxy S23 likely won’t launch for several more weeks, Samsung is already making enhancements to the cameras on its current Galaxy phones. It added a new feature to the Expert Raw app that helps stargazers take better photos of constellations, similar to Google’s Astrophotography feature for Pixel phones. There’s also a new Camera Assistant app that lets you enable or disable certain features, like a faster shutter or automatic lens switching.
Faster charging that doesn’t cost so much
The Galaxy S22 lineup supports fast charging of up to 25 watts for the Galaxy S22 and 45 watts for the Galaxy S22 Plus and Ultra. But you have to purchase a separate charger to do so. Samsung charges $50 for the 45-watt charger and $35 for the 25-watt charger, although you can often find them for less through retailers like Amazon and Walmart. In some scenarios, I also didn’t notice much of a difference between the pricier 45-watt charger and Samsung’s less expensive 25-watt charger when powering up the Galaxy S22 Plus, which you can read more about here.
With the Galaxy S23, I’d like to see a more noticeable improvement in charging speeds, as well as more affordable charger options. The OnePlus 10 Pro, for example, offers either 65- or 80-watt fast charging depending on your region, both of which are speedier than what Samsung has to offer on paper. OnePlus also includes a compatible power adapter in the box.
Samsung and Apple stopped including power adapters in their product packaging to cut down on waste, which is an admirable cause. But I at least wish Samsung would let you choose to include a fast-charging compatible adapter as an option for a discounted price when ordering a new phone, similar to the way it lets you select a storage option or add Samsung Care Plus.
If rumors turn out to be accurate, the base Galaxy S23 model might have the same 25-watt charging speed as the Galaxy S22. That’s according to Ice Universe, a Twitter account with a history of publishing details about unreleased Samsung products.
Samsung is already doing a lot right with the Galaxy S22, particularly when it comes to software support and display quality. But as year-over-year smartphone upgrades have become more incremental than revolutionary, focusing on core elements like the camera and battery are as important as ever.

Google races to put Gemini at the center of Android before Apple’s AI reboot
Google is using its latest Android rollout to position Gemini as the AI layer across phones, Chrome, laptops and cars.
Google is using its latest Android rollout to make Gemini less of a chatbot and more of an operating layer across the phone, browser, car and laptop, just weeks before Apple is expected to show its own Gemini-powered Apple Intelligence reboot at WWDC.
Ahead of its Google I/O developer conference next week, the company previewed a number of Android updates, including AI-powered app automation, a smarter version of Chrome on Android, new tools for creators, a redesigned Android Auto experience, and a sweeping set of new security features.
Alphabet is counting on Gemini to help Google compete directly with OpenAI and Anthropic in the market for artificial intelligence models and services, while also serving as the AI backbone across its expansive portfolio of products, including Android. Meanwhile, Gemini is powering part of Apple’s new AI strategy, giving Google a role in the iPhone maker’s reset even as it races to prove its own version of personal AI on the phone is further along.
Sameer Samat, who oversees Google’s Android ecosystem, told CNBC that Google is rebuilding parts of Android around Gemini Intelligence to help users complete everyday tasks more easily.
“We’re transitioning from an operating system to an intelligence system,” he said.
As part of Tuesday’s announcements. Google said Gemini Intelligence will be able to move across apps, understand what’s on the screen and complete tasks that would normally require a user to jump between multiple services. That means Android is moving beyond the traditional assistant model, where users ask a question and get an answer, and acting more like an agent.
For instance, Google says Gemini can pull relevant information from Gmail, build shopping carts and book reservations. Samat gave the example of asking Gemini to look at the guest list for a barbecue, build a menu, add ingredients to an Instacart list and return for approval before checkout.
A big concern surrounding agentic AI involves software taking action on a user’s behalf without permissions. Samat said Gemini will come back to the user before completing a transaction, adding, “the human is always in the loop.”
Four months after announcing its Gemini deal with Google, Apple is under pressure to show a more capable version of Apple Intelligence, which has been a relative laggard on the market. Apple has long framed privacy, hardware integration and control of the user experience as its advantages.
Google’s Android push is designed to show it can bring AI deeper into the device experience while still giving users control over what Gemini can see, where it can act and when it needs confirmation.
The app automation features will roll out in waves, starting with the latest Samsung Galaxy and Google Pixel phones this summer, before expanding across more Android devices, including watches, cars, glasses and laptops later this year.
The company is also redesigning Android Auto around Gemini, turning the car into another major surface for its assistant. Android Auto is in more than 250 million cars, and Google says the new release includes its biggest maps update in a decade and Gemini-powered help with tasks like ordering dinner while driving.
Alphabet’s AI strategy has been embraced by Wall Street, which has pushed the company’s stock price up more than 140% in the past year, compared to Apple’s roughly 40% gain. Investors now want to see how Gemini can become more central to the products people use every day.

Waymo recalls 3,800 robotaxis after glitch allowed some vehicles to ‘drive into standing water’
Waymo issued a voluntary recall of about 3,800 of its robotaxis to fix software issues that could allow them to drive into flooded roadways.
Waymo is recalling about 3,800 robotaxis in the U.S. to fix software issues that could allow them to “drive onto a flooded roadway,” according to a letter on the National Highway Traffic Safety Administration’s website.
The voluntary recall is for Waymo vehicles that use the company’s fifth and sixth generation automated driving systems (or ADS), the U.S. auto safety regulator said in the letter posted Tuesday.
Waymo autonomous vehicles in Austin, Texas, were seen on camera driving onto a flooded street and stalling, requiring other drivers to navigate around them. It’s the latest example of a safety-related issue for the Alphabet-owned AV unit that’s rapidly bolstering its fleet of vehicles and entering new U.S. markets.
Waymo has drawn criticism for its vehicles failing to yield to school buses in Austin, and for the performance of its vehicles during widespread power outages in San Francisco in December, when robotaxis halted in traffic, causing gridlock.
The company said in a statement on Tuesday that it’s “identified an area of improvement regarding untraversable flooded lanes specific to higher-speed roadways,” and opted to file a “voluntary software recall” with the NHTSA.
“Waymo provides over half a million trips every week in some of the most challenging driving environments across the U.S., and safety is our primary priority,” the company said.
Waymo added that it’s working on “additional software safeguards” and has put “mitigations” in place, limiting where its robotaxis operate during extreme weather, so that they avoid “areas where flash flooding might occur” in periods of intense rain.

Qualcomm tumbles 13% as semiconductor stocks retreat from historic AI-fueled surge
Semiconductor equities reversed sharply after a broad AI-driven advance, with Qualcomm suffering its worst day since 2020 amid inflation concerns and rising oil prices.
Semiconductor stocks fell sharply on Tuesday, reversing course after an extensive rally that had expanded the artificial intelligence investment theme well past Nvidia and driven the industry to unprecedented levels.
Qualcomm plunged 13% and was on track for its steepest single-day decline since 2020. Intel shed 8%, while On Semiconductor and Skyworks Solutions each lost more than 6%. The iShares Semiconductor ETF, which benchmarks the overall sector, fell 5%.
The sell-off came after a key gauge of consumer prices came in above forecasts, and as conflict in Iran pushed crude oil higher—prompting investors to shift away from riskier assets.
The preceding advance had widened the AI opportunity set beyond longtime industry leader Nvidia, which for much of the past several years had largely carried the market to new peaks on its own.
Explosive appetite for central processing units, along with the graphics processing units that power large language models, has sent chipmakers to all-time highs.
Market participants are wagering that the shift from AI model training to autonomous agents will lift demand for additional AI hardware. Among the beneficiaries are memory chip producers, which are raising prices as supply remains tight.
Micron Technology slid 6%, and Sandisk cratered 8%. Sandisk’s stock has surged more than six times over since January.
